What is a Mutual Termination Of Employment Letter?

The Mutual Termination Of Employment Letter is utilized when both employer and employee agree to end their employment relationship amicably under Canadian law. This document is essential in situations where both parties have reached a mutual understanding regarding the termination of employment and wish to formalize the arrangement in writing. It typically includes critical information such as the effective termination date, final compensation details, benefit arrangements, confidentiality obligations, and mutual releases. The letter must comply with both federal and provincial employment standards legislation in Canada, ensuring all statutory requirements are met. It serves as a crucial risk management tool by clearly documenting the agreed-upon terms and helping prevent future disputes or legal challenges. This document is particularly valuable when organizations need to maintain positive relationships with departing employees while ensuring legal compliance and protecting both parties' interests.

What sections should be included in a Mutual Termination Of Employment Letter?

1. Date and Address Block: Current date and full contact details of both employer and employee

2. Subject Line: Clear indication that this is a mutual termination of employment agreement

3. Opening Statement: Confirmation of mutual agreement to terminate employment relationship

4. Employment Details: Employee's name, position, and duration of employment

5. Termination Date: Clear statement of the agreed-upon last day of employment

6. Final Pay Details: Breakdown of final salary, outstanding vacation pay, and any other statutory entitlements

7. Company Property: List of company property to be returned and deadline for return

8. Confidentiality Obligations: Reminder of ongoing confidentiality obligations post-employment

9. Mutual Release: Statement releasing both parties from future claims related to employment

10. Signature Block: Space for both parties to sign and date the letter

What sections are optional to include in a Mutual Termination Of Employment Letter?

1. Reference Provision: Details about providing employment references, used when specifically agreed upon

2. Non-Competition/Non-Solicitation: Reminder of existing post-employment restrictions, included if such agreements were part of original employment terms

3. Benefits Continuation: Details of any benefits extending beyond termination date, included if applicable

4. Severance Package: Details of any additional compensation beyond statutory requirements, included if offered

5. Outplacement Services: Description of any career transition support offered, included if part of termination package

6. Stock Options/Equity: Treatment of any outstanding stock options or equity compensation, included if applicable

What schedules should be included in a Mutual Termination Of Employment Letter?

1. Schedule A - Financial Statement: Detailed breakdown of final payment calculations including salary, benefits, and statutory entitlements

2. Schedule B - Company Property List: Itemized list of company property to be returned

3. Schedule C - Benefit Continuation Details: Specific information about post-employment benefits and coverage periods
